Can You Get a Divorce Without a Residence Permit in Ukraine

One of the most common questions is: can you get divorced without a residence permit? The answer is generally yes. Ukrainian family law does not make the existence of a residence permit an absolute requirement for terminating a marriage.

A registered address may influence procedural matters, such as determining jurisdiction, delivering court documents, or identifying the appropriate authority. However, the lack of registration itself does not deprive a person of the right to divorce.

This rule is particularly important for internally displaced persons, Ukrainians who moved abroad, individuals who have sold their property and deregistered, and spouses whose registration information is outdated.

In many situations, divorce without registered place of residence is handled through court proceedings where additional information about actual residence, last known address, or other relevant circumstances is provided.

Divorce Without Registration Through the Civil Registry Office

In limited situations, spouses may terminate a marriage through the civil registry office even when registration issues exist. The key factor is not the residence permit itself but whether the legal conditions for an administrative divorce are satisfied. Generally, spouses must have no minor children and both must agree to terminate the marriage.

If these requirements are met, the civil registry office may process the divorce based on the submitted documentation and identity records. How to File for Divorce if the Respondent Has No Registered Address

A frequent challenge arises when one spouse cannot identify the respondent’s current registration. People often ask how to file for divorce without registration when the other spouse’s address is unknown or outdated. The court typically requires the claimant to provide all available information regarding the respondent’s last known location, place of work, relatives, communication history, or other identifying details.

The objective is to demonstrate that reasonable efforts have been made to identify the respondent’s whereabouts. Courts understand that spouses may lose contact after separation, especially when many years have passed or when one spouse has moved abroad. Therefore, the inability to provide a current registered address does not automatically block the case. What matters is the claimant’s ability to provide truthful information and cooperate with procedural requirements.

Divorce Without Residence Permit and Without Personal Attendance

One of the most requested services today is divorce without residence permit and without personal attendance. This option is particularly valuable for individuals living abroad, military personnel, displaced persons, and people whose work or family circumstances make travel difficult.

Remote legal support allows many procedural steps to be completed without visiting a court personally. Important! A lawyer represents the client’s interests on the basis of a legal assistance agreement, which may be concluded online. A power of attorney is not required for this purpose.

This significantly simplifies access to legal protection and enables efficient management of divorce proceedings from any location. In many cases, divorce without presence is the most practical format when the client cannot attend court personally.
